The plot of Alice in Wonderland or What's a Nice Kid Like You Doing in a Place Like This? centers on a unique premise within the Fantasy landscape.
A loose adaptation and parody of the Lewis Carroll tale by Hanna-Barbera Productions. A modern-day teenager doing a book report on Alice is accidentally sucked into her television set and ends up in a wacky version of Wonderland.
